JDK Installation Instruction Notation for Windows For any text in this document that contains the following notation, you must substitute the appropriate update version number: interim. Note: Verify the successful completion of file download by comparing the file size on the download page and your local drive.

Alternatively, you can ensure that the downloaded file's checksum matches the one provided on the Java SE Downloads page.

The PATH environment variable is a series of directories separated by semicolons ; and is not case-sensitive. You should only have one bin directory for a JDK in the path at a time. Those following the first instance are ignored. The new path takes effect in each new command window you open after setting the PATH variable.

New Checks on Trust Anchor Certificates New checks have been added to ensure that trust anchors are CA certificates and contain proper extensions. Trust anchors are used to validate certificate chains used in TLS and signed code. Trust anchor certificates must include a Basic Constraints extension with the cA field set to true.

Also, if they include a Key Usage extension, the keyCertSign bit must be set. A new system property named jdk.
